On Saturday, the IC Catholic Prep Knights came up short against the Downers Grove South Mustangs and fell 2-0. The Knights have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
While IC Catholic Prep was not able to win a set, they sure kept things interesting: every set was decided by exactly two points.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-23, 25-23.
Niya Mincheva was the offensive standout of the matchup as she had four aces and three digs. That's the most aces she has posted since back in September.
IC Catholic Prep's defeat dropped their record down to 19-14. As for Downers Grove South, they have been performing well recently as they've won six of their last eight games, which provided a nice bump to their 20-10 record this season.
IC Catholic Prep will be staying on the road on Tuesday to face off against Horizon Science Academy-Southwest at 5:00 p.m. As for Downers Grove South, they will look to defend their home court on Tuesday against Hinsdale South at 5:30 p.m.
